How they compare

North Korea currently reports 719.97 hectares against 509.72 hectares in Brunei, a difference of 210.25 hectares.

That makes North Korea's figure about 1.4 times Brunei's.

The two have swapped places 4 times across 24 shared years of data; in 2001 it was North Korea ahead.

Brunei ranks 85th and North Korea ranks 82nd of 187 countries.

North Korea has averaged higher in every one of the 3 decades both report.

Head to head by decade

Decade Brunei North Korea Difference Ahead
2000s 574.79 hectares 3,124 hectares 2,550 hectares North Korea
2010s 587.73 hectares 2,246 hectares 1,658 hectares North Korea
2020s 407.06 hectares 1,363 hectares 956.09 hectares North Korea

Averages of every year both report within each decade.
